Flood damage restoration services involve the process of assessing, cleaning, and repairing properties affected by water intrusion. When flooding occurs, whether from natural events like heavy rain or plumbing failures, water can quickly seep into floors, walls, and structural components. Restoration professionals use specialized equipment and techniques to remove standing water, dry out affected areas, and prevent further issues such as mold growth or structural deterioration. The goal is to restore the property to a safe and habitable condition while minimizing long-term damage caused by excess moisture.

These services address a variety of problems associated with flood damage. Water intrusion can compromise building materials, weaken foundations, and cause mold and bacteria growth that pose health risks. Additionally, floodwaters can carry debris, chemicals, and sewage, which require thorough cleaning and disinfection. Restoration professionals help mitigate these hazards by removing contaminated materials, performing thorough cleaning, and applying antimicrobial treatments. This process helps protect property owners from ongoing damage and potential health concerns linked to residual moisture or mold.

The overview below groups typical Flood Damage Restoration proj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Carver County, MN.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Assessment and Inspection - The cost for evaluating flood damage typically ranges from $200 to $600, depending on the property's size and severity of the damage. This initial step helps determine necessary restoration services and scope.

Water Extraction and Drying - Expect expenses between $1,000 and $3,500 for removing standing water and thoroughly drying affected areas. Larger properties or extensive flooding can increase these costs.

Structural Repairs - Repair costs for damaged walls, flooring, and foundations generally fall between $2,500 and $10,000, influenced by the extent of structural compromise and materials needed.

Mold Remediation - Mold removal services after flood damage typically range from $500 to $3,000, depending on the affected area size and contamination levels. Professional remediation is essential for safety and health.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are the common signs of flood damage? Signs include water stains on walls or ceilings, a musty odor, warped flooring, and visible debris or mud in the affected area.

How long does flood damage restoration typically take? The duration varies based on the extent of the damage, but professional restoration services aim to complete cleanup and drying efficiently to prevent further issues.

Are there health risks associated with flood-damaged properties? Yes, floodwaters can carry bacteria, mold, and other contaminants that may pose health risks, making professional cleanup important.

What steps do restoration services usually perform? Services often include water extraction, drying and dehumidification, mold prevention, cleaning, and sanitization of affected areas.
